Lost Keys
The Audi Advanced Key system is an excellent feature that allows you to start the car and then open the doors without ever needing to get your hands off of the steering wheel or reach into your pockets. This is an excellent feature for those who carry equipment or groceries for your children, loading them into the car, or do not want to take off your gloves to unlock the car.
In the event that your Audi Advanced Key fob is lost, you'll need to work with an authorized dealership to get a replacement. This typically requires specialized knowledge and equipment. It can also take time, because the new key must be programmed to work with your vehicle's security system.
You can purchase a replacement key from an Audi dealer, but it will take a few days for them to get the immobiliser number from Germany and then program it into your vehicle. Alternately, you can purchase a replacement key from a locksmith. The key will have to be programmed and cut to be compatible with the system of your vehicle. This process requires expert skills and equipment.
Replacement Keys
To get a replacement for your car key, you must first buy the right key from a dealership or a locksmith who is certified. Then, you must program it so that it works with your vehicle's security system. This is a time-consuming procedure that requires specialist equipment and knowledge. It is also important to inform your insurance provider that you lost the key, so that they can identify your vehicle as "at risk" in the event that it is stolen.

Use a ruler or something similar, that is less than 2 millimeters in thickness to poke the slit on the bottom of your Audi Smart Key and pry open the shell. The positive pole on the battery should be facing upwards. Then, you can place the battery replacement into the slot and snap the shell into the slot.
